Second-half scoring spree lifts Auks in field hockey opener

758

 

CLAYMONT – Archmere, which won just two games all last season, got off to a positive start this year with a 7-0 field hockey win over Concord Friday afternoon in the season opener for both teams. The Auks broke open a close matchup with six second-half goals.

Archmere (1-0) had several early chances but couldn’t break through until senior Kennedy Murphy scored off a penalty corner from Lorin Donovan with 19:50 to go in the half. Meanwhile, sophomore goalkeeper Mady McDougal turned away everything the Raiders (0-1) threw at her, posting seven saves in the shutout.

The second half was all Archmere. Junior Leah DaCosta scored her first goal off a feed from Donovan, then DaCosta picked up the assist on Archmere’s next goal, which came off the stick of senior Sarah Bunting. The Auks scored three more times in the next 10 minutes, one from Murphy and two more for DaCosta, who completed the hat trick. Senior Presley Conaty added the final tally in the last minute of the contest.

Archmere is at St. Elizabeth Tuesday at 3:45 p.m., while Concord travels to Middletown on Wednesday to meet the Cavaliers.
